Now, choose the type of graph. Kibana 4 Tutorial – Part 3: Visualize. This includes everything from running ad hoc queries, creating visualizations such as line charts and pie charts, and displaying data on dashboards. Click on Visualize on the left hand side of Kibana. The Templated Query Viewer allows to create a visualization with the output of a template run on a set of queries. Recommended Articles. In Kibana 3 I can easily create a histogram and select specific queries I want to base the data on. Simple queries on fields. Kibana provides rich, intuitive data visualizations for that data that is indexed in Elastic Search. Kibana is a great analysis and visualization tool. Definitions let … 5) above. To create a schedule-based report, choose Create report definition. Creating a shared filter. This is part 3 of the Kibana 4 tutorial series. The easy-to-use Kibana interface allows developers and Business end users to query data, create catchy charts, thereby visualize the results via different chart types. Kibana visualizations are based on Elasticsearch queries. Click on the blue plus sign. The visualization makes it easy to predict or to see the changes in trends of errors or other significant events of the input source. For an absolute time we have to use the time filter option. You should be welcomed by an empty screen telling you to Drop some fields. This option pre-fills many of the fields for you based on the visualization, dashboard, or data you were viewing. This part explains how to create new visualizations on your data. It is a great way to get an idea of how to use Kibana and create a … Kibana will then ask for a field containing a timestamp which it should use for visualizing time-series data. It explainst different aggregation types and how to use them in different visualization types. Thanks! Kibana enables you to easily interact with your data, providing a much better experience than writing Elasticsearch queries. It is as easy as making a curl request. The visualization makes it easy to predict or to see the changes in trends of errors or other significant events of the input source. Now we can open the Visualize app in Kibana. Select the following items in the menu: Source query: last weather conditions; Template: weather template; Test the visualization by clicking on the green button . Create Visualization. Once you do understand the query languages that Kibana supports, then the charts you can create are complex and detailed and you can save queries to recreate visuals with up-to-date data. The Elastic demo dashboard allows you to create your own visualizations, adding your own visualization types and data sources. To create visualizations based on the data in your Amazon ES indexes, use the visualization function. Do anything from tracking query load to understanding the way requests flow through your apps.” Image Sourced from elastic.co. Tim Roes. Steps to create POST link for PDF: Go to the visualization of the Kibana and choose the time filter option. Kibana is a free, open-source analytics, monitoring, and visualization platform that was created in 2013 by Elastic. Kibana is an open source analytics and visualization platform from ELK stack. By clicking elements of visualizations. Its main attribute is its ability to chain functions, using a timelion specific syntax to create a very specific visualization that visual editor can't perform. While there is no doubt that the more recent versions of Kibana, 5.x and more so — 6.x, have made huge progress from a UI and UX perspective, there are some small missing bits and pieces that can make monitoring and troubleshooting a tad cumbersome. You’ll find it in the left menu → Create new visualization → and then pick the Lens visualization type (first in the selection grid). Kibana enables you to easily interact with your data, providing a much better experience than writing Elasticsearch queries. For now, I’ll stick with Kibana. The interface for adding filters is really comfy — check it out: Nothing limits you to write complex filters that are based on multiple fields and conditions. Slicing and dicing data is easy, and navigating between different datasets can be done without losing context. The following queries can always be used in Kibana at the top of the Discover tab, your visualization and/or dashboards. As I progress, I imagine I will be using python pandas and matplotlib more to quickly sift through data. Create visualizations from a search saved from the discovery function or start with a new search query. Since we now explained how Elasticsearch indexes the data, we can continue with the actual topic: searching. Create reports using a definition. no. Here we can see the visualizations that are already created. In our case, we type products, so as to create our Kibana index. While there is no development necessary, we still need a technical user to build the visualization source (query), search definition, push data into ElasticSearch and develop/import the visualizations back into PeopleSoft. Kibana - Overview.Kibana is an open source browser based visualization tool mainly used to analyse large volume of logs in the form of line graph, bar graph, pie charts , heat maps, region maps, coordinate maps, gauge, goals, timelion etc. line chart).. This is a guide to Kibana Visualization. Create a query where you select those event you need. We assume you have completed at least the steps in Part 1 – Introduction. Then visualisations -> vertical bar Change the Y-Xasis to Sum() and select the field that hold the goals for the users. If you’ve used Kibana, then you probably know how easy it is to create a dashboard via the GUI. You can create charts that show trends, spikes, and dips by using a series of Amazon ES aggregations to extract and process data. Paul. Enter the name of the index that was specified before when inserting the data with Logstash (“stock”). For this example, we are going to select a Vertical Bar chart. I use Kibana exclusively for EDA and creating visualizations in order to try and understand data. In this example, we will choose Horizontal Bar graph. With Kibana, you can visualize the data stored within an Elasticsearch cluster. By using a series of Elasticsearch aggregations to extract and process your data, you can create charts that show you the trends, spikes, and dips you need to know about. Go to Kibana Visualization as shown below − We do not have any visualization created, so it shows blank and there is a button to create one. Feb 7, 2015 22 min read. But we will create only just a simple bar chart. But just like any piece of software, it is not perfect. To create a new one, click on the + icon. Select bucket type X-Axsis -> term aggr and select the users name. Visualization¶ Kibana will also give you the option to create visualizations or graphs. Kibana discover page. However, In Kibana 4 I can seemingly only select one single query for the visualization, and I'm at loss as to how to visualize two fields from different document types. This includes everything from running ad hoc queries, creating visualizations such as line charts and pie charts, and displaying data on dashboards. You can easily perform advanced data analysis and visualize your data in a variety of charts, tables, maps and create your own dashboards and visualizations. Next, we have to choose the source or the index pattern available. Kibana is an open source browser based visualization tool mainly used to analyze large volume of logs in the form of line graph, bar graph, pie charts, heat maps, region maps, coordinate maps, gauge, goals, timelion etc. Go the to the “Visualize” tab and create such a new visualization. Sample of visualization. Custom visualizations in Kibana. Kibana visualizations are based on Amazon ES queries. Why Timelion rather than bar or pie chart ? Create a number of custom Kibana visualizations, including a bar visualization and a Sankey chart, using Vega and Vega-Lite. The second issue was being able to extract out the uptime bot requests from all the other requests. By using a series of Elasticsearch aggregations to extract and process your data, you can create charts that show you the trends, spikes, and dips you need to know about.. Kibana now also available on Amazon premises EC2 or Amazon Elasticsearch Service. Kibana visualizations are based on Elasticsearch queries. Now the Kibana toolbar will show the share option as shown (Fig. What you may not know is that it is also possible to dynamically create kibana dashboards and visualizations! This sample Kibana custom visualization plugin, based on the NP framework, allows enhancement via simple coding of a simple UI to adjust the query and time filter of a dashboard Topics kibana form kibana-visualization kibana-plugin custom-form I'm convinced its possible, I just dont know how to do it in Kibana 4. PeopleSoft now seamlessly integrates with Kibana, allowing transparent user access to various visualizations. It allows to retrieve and analyse data in time order. Create a visualization Kibana allows the user to visualize the data in the Elasticsearch indices with a variety of charts, tables and maps.. To create a visualization, select Visualize from the left pane menu, then + or Create a visualization, and choose the visualization type that better serves your purpose (e.g. We have to choose a PDF option and create a PDF link. Timelion is an visualization tool for time series in Kibana. Please note that this blog only covers delivered index patterns. Make sure Kibana is running and log in to the console, under the ‘Management’ tab you can find the option to create an Index pattern under Kibana. We are going to create a chart to show number of hits/requests in a month using the same query we used above. Kibana features as an ideal tool: For searching, viewing and visualizing data By writing a search query using either the Kibana Query Language (KBL) or Lucene as a syntax. There are different types of Kibana visualizations that you can use with the most fequently used including; It also allows much more. On this page, you can filter documents. This is a very convenient tool to query your data. Once created the index, in the Discover section, it is possible to filter the data by date or by one or more fields: Using the search bar, we can query between products using the KQL language (Kibana Query language), which allows you to easily query using the autocomplete. Then proceed to Create reports using a definition. Creating a visualization. Once logged into Kibana, the first step is to create the visualization. Also not only Kibana, we can use other open-source tools for proper data visualization but Kibana is a part of ELK stack, so it’s easy to ingest data from Elasticsearch indices to Kibana. In the past, extending Kibana with customized visualizations meant building a Kibana plugin, but since version 6.2, users can accomplish the same goal more easily and from within Kibana using Vega and Vega-Lite — an open source, and relatively easy-to-use, JSON-based declarative languages. Dashboard: A dashboard is a collection of visualizations, searches, and maps, typically in real-time. Why Kibana ? So let’s drop some! We could have done this with filters in Kibana, but the issue here is that then each visualisation you create in Kibana would need to have the same filter applied to it. In this article, I’m going to go show some basic examples of how you can use these … Click the button Create a visualization as shown in the screen above and it will take you to the screen as shown below − Here you can select the option which you need to visualize your data. This includes everything from running ad hoc queries, creating visualizations such as line charts and pie charts, and displaying data on dashboards. You use Kibana to search, view, and interact with data stored in Elasticsearch.